探讨Rust语言及其micromath数学库在手游嵌入式系统中的前沿应用。
近年来,随着移动游戏行业的蓬勃发展,玩家对游戏性能与体验的要求日益提升,在这一背景下,高效、安全的编程语言及其相关库成为了开发者们竞相追逐的热点,Rust语言,凭借其内存安全、高性能及并发处理的优势,在手游嵌入式系统领域崭露头角,而micromath,作为Rust语言中的一个重要数学库,更是为手游开发带来了前所未有的创新机遇,本文将深入剖析Rust语言及其micromath数学库在手游嵌入式系统中的具体应用,展现其如何助力游戏性能优化与体验升级。

中心句:Rust语言特性及其在手游开发中的优势。
Rust语言自诞生以来,便以其独特的内存管理机制和强大的类型系统赢得了业界的广泛关注,在手游开发中,Rust语言的优势尤为明显,其内存安全特性有效避免了内存泄漏、野指针等常见安全问题,降低了游戏崩溃的风险;Rust语言的高性能表现使得游戏在复杂场景下的运行更加流畅,为玩家提供了更为极致的游戏体验,Rust语言的并发处理能力也为手游的多线程优化提供了有力支持,进一步提升了游戏的运行效率。

中心句:micromath数学库介绍及其在手游开发中的应用。
micromath,作为Rust语言中的一个重要数学库,为手游开发提供了丰富的数学运算功能,该库不仅包含了基础的加减乘除、三角函数等运算,还支持向量、矩阵等高级数学运算,为游戏的物理模拟、图形渲染等关键环节提供了强有力的支持,在手游开发中,micromath数学库的应用广泛而深入,在物理引擎中,开发者可以利用micromath进行精确的碰撞检测与物理模拟;在图形渲染方面,micromath则能够助力开发者实现更为逼真的光影效果与动画表现,可以说,micromath数学库的出现,为手游开发带来了更为广阔的创新空间。
中心句:Rust语言与micromath数学库在手游嵌入式系统中的实践案例。
在实际应用中,Rust语言与micromath数学库的结合为手游嵌入式系统带来了显著的性能提升,以某知名手游为例,该游戏在引入Rust语言及micromath数学库后,游戏帧率得到了显著提升,玩家在游戏过程中的卡顿现象明显减少,由于Rust语言的内存安全特性,该游戏的崩溃率也大幅下降,为玩家提供了更为稳定的游戏环境,micromath数学库的应用还使得该游戏的物理模拟与图形渲染效果更加逼真,为玩家带来了更为沉浸式的游戏体验。
参考来源:相关Rust语言及micromath数学库的官方文档与开发者社区讨论。
最新问答:
1、问:Rust语言在手游开发中的最大优势是什么?
答:Rust语言在手游开发中的最大优势在于其内存安全特性和高性能表现,这使得游戏在复杂场景下的运行更加流畅,同时降低了游戏崩溃的风险。
2、问:micromath数学库在手游开发中主要有哪些应用场景?
答:micromath数学库在手游开发中主要应用于物理模拟、图形渲染等关键环节,它提供了丰富的数学运算功能,为游戏的物理效果与视觉效果提供了强有力的支持。
3、问:未来Rust语言及micromath数学库在手游开发中会有哪些发展趋势?
答:随着移动游戏行业的不断发展,Rust语言及micromath数学库在手游开发中的应用将会更加广泛,预计它们将在游戏性能优化、跨平台开发等方面发挥更加重要的作用,为玩家带来更为极致的游戏体验。